From September 1, 2025, preschools will be closed until 8:00 p.m. Teachers are outraged by the decision.

Sosnowiec will launch a pilot program in three city kindergartens , which will see them open until 8 p.m. Infor.pl explains that this is intended to address the needs of parents working shifts, single parents, or those without family support.
Damian Żurawski, chairman of the Education Committee at the Sosnowiec City Hall, announced the initiative. He also noted his hope that other cities will follow suit.
Not everyone, however, shares his optimism. Educators commenting on the solution have many reservations. Katarzyna, a preschool teacher quoted by Infor, shared her opinion and stated that "it is not consistent with the developmental needs of young children or with the idea of preschool education as a stage supporting children in their natural rhythm of life, learning, and rest."
" Kindergarten shouldn't replace home . Its role is to support a child's development, but not to replace the family in the day-to-day upbringing," she emphasizes.
He also points out that " extending kindergarten opening hours to 8 p.m. is a step towards institutionalizing childhood , which may negatively impact family relationships, children's social development and their mental health."
Instead of extending the opening hours of state kindergartens, the company advises looking for solutions that support parents in reconciling work and family life - such as flexible working hours, the possibility of remote work or the creation of emergency care points in exceptional situations.
"Children from families where they are most welcome outside the home are kept in prison until the end"Her colleague, Ms. Asia, also has concerns. She points out that the parents who most readily use such solutions aren't necessarily the ones who need them the most.
"I look at the situation from the perspective of a teacher who works at a school. I've been through the school after-school program more than once, and in my experience, children from families where the child is simply most welcome outside the home are stuck there until the very end," she laments. "I've often witnessed the tragedies of children who expected love and attention, but instead sat and waited for their mother, who "simply" arrived at the last minute, and often late because "there was traffic," and she took advantage of the time without the children to go shopping," she tells Infor.
